Transaction 52ea4a19893447371f98e2707ea57a2250dca48bc5d6ac6dd16c2eac776c44bb
2 Input
2 Outputs
- 52ea4a19893447371f98e2707ea57a2250dca48bc5d6ac6dd16c2eac776c44bb:0
- 52ea4a19893447371f98e2707ea57a2250dca48bc5d6ac6dd16c2eac776c44bb:1
value 729231
address 3MZz8okkCKzT6TkAQRX7X5VvM3vapvFG9U
value 775879
address 17oQsrTF6BFPbwGGtcVMSpmpAnvTg9phc